Full Accreditation Review – 2007
Mt. Hood Community College's full accreditation review in October 2007
Every ten years colleges and universities in the Pacific Northwest are reviewed by the Northwest Commission on Colleges and Universities (NWCCU). The review is performed by a team of peer evaluators from other colleges in the Northwest, generally outside of the institution's home state. MHCC's most recent full-scale review occurred October 8 - 10, 2007. MHCC's accreditation status was reaffirmed as a result of the review.
